Odor: Sweet, yet spicy. Smoky, woody and nutty with some balsamic notes. Reminiscent of fresh Evergreens.
Botanical Name: Cupressus sempervirens
Country of Origin: Spain
Extraction Technique: Steam Distilled
Components: Needles
Color: Pale yellow
Note: Base
Viscosity: Liquid
Properties: Diuretic, respiratory aid, sedative. Cleansing and warm. Helps mental focus and concentration. Restores balance and gives a soothing comfortable feeling of well being.
Possible Uses: Excellent oil to stabalize moods and help in times of grief and depression.
Great with: Cedarwood and Pine, Mandarin & Orange, Cardamom, Clary Sage, Jasmine, Juniper, Lavender, Marjoram, Rose (which makes an excellent blend for comfort in stressful time), Sandalwood and many more. Can be added to a diffuser, added to a massage oil, or sniffed directly.
History & Facts: Derived from the Greek word "Senpervirenc" which means lives forever. Ancient Mediterranean trees prized for their sleek calm appearance. A cousin of Juniper, its often found in older cemeteries, giving credence to its "ability to ease grief & sadness". Today, Cypress can be found in many popular mens toiletries.
Safety Information: Non-toxic. Should not irritate when used correctly. Avoid during pregnancy.
